Abstract
Purpose of review: In recent years, there has been a flurry of activity in the human epidermal growth factor receptor 2 (HER2)-positive metastatic breast cancer space. New, powerful drugs like trastuzumab deruxtecan have challenged our fundamental definition of what HER2 expression means as a predictive biomarker.
Recent findings: Recent approvals of multiple agents in the second line-metastatic setting have given patients access to a variety of new agents, but also raise questions with regard to optimal sequencing.
Summary: This review will explore current issues with HER2 testing, recently approved drugs in the HER2+ and HER2 low spaces, as well as novel agents/combinations on the horizon.
